Owning your ideal home is a wonderful goal for numerous people. But the traditional mortgage process can sometimes be challenging. That's where private mortgages come in. A private mortgage is a loan that is provided by a non-bank lender, rather than a standard bank or financial institution. This can provide several perks for borrowers who may not qualify for a regular mortgage.
A key advantage of a private mortgage is that lenders are often more adaptable with their requirements. They may be willing to consider borrowers who have less credit history, fair credit scores, or unique employment situations. Additionally, private lenders may be quicker to approve loan applications, which can minimize time and stress.

Bridge the Gap: Private Mortgage Solutions for Challenging Credit
For individuals facing credit challenges, acquiring a traditional mortgage can seem like an insurmountable roadblock. Fortunately, private mortgage solutions provide a path to homeownership. These programs are designed to consider borrowers with less-than-perfect credit scores by offering more lenient lending criteria. With a private mortgage, you may be able to secure financing even if you have past foreclosures.
Private lenders often concentrate on your earnings and current economic situation rather than solely relying on your credit history. This can open doors to homeownership for those who have struggled in the past.
- Explore different private mortgage lenders to find one that most effectively aligns with your requirements.
- Boost your credit score whenever possible, as it can still affect the terms of your loan.
- Make transparent about your financial history with the lender to build trust and increase your chances of approval.
